Eugene O'Neill's ""The Hairy Ape"" remains a powerful and relevant exploration of identity and alienation in a world defined by class conflict. This expressionistic drama delves into the experiences of unskilled laborers, offering a stark social commentary on the dehumanizing effects of industrial society. The play unflinchingly examines themes of social injustice, challenging audiences to confront the realities of a world divided by economic disparity.

Through its unflinching portrayal of individuals struggling to find their place, ""The Hairy Ape"" has secured its place as a vital work of dramatic literature. This edition preserves the historical text for readers interested in labor relations and the evolution of dramatic expression, allowing them to experience O'Neill's vision as it was originally intended. Its enduring themes resonate across generations, making it a compelling and thought-provoking read.
